Facebook in Malaysia: A Brief Overview

Facebook, launched in 2004 by Mark Zuckerberg, has grown to become the largest social networking site in the world. In Malaysia, Facebook has become a significant part of the social fabric, with millions of users connecting with friends, family, and colleagues. The platform has also become a powerful tool for businesses, brands, and influencers to reach their target audience.

Active Facebook Users in Malaysia

As of the latest available data, the number of Facebook users in Malaysia is estimated to be around 20 million. This figure is a testament to the platform\'s popularity and its ability to connect people across the nation. With such a large user base, Facebook has become a crucial platform for businesses looking to tap into the Malaysian market.

Impact of Facebook in Malaysia

Facebook has had a profound impact on various aspects of life in Malaysia. Here are some key areas where Facebook has made a significant difference:

1. Social Interaction

Facebook has revolutionized the way Malaysians interact with each other. With features like messenger, groups, and events, users can stay connected with friends and family, regardless of geographical barriers. This has led to a stronger sense of community and social cohesion.

2. Information Sharing

In Malaysia, Facebook is a primary source of news and information. Users rely on the platform to stay updated with the latest local and international news, events, and trends. 3. Business and Marketing

For businesses, Facebook has become a vital marketing channel. With targeted advertising options and the ability to reach a specific demographic, companies can effectively promote their products and services. Many small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) have leveraged Facebook to grow their businesses and reach new customers.

4. Education and Learning

Facebook has also become a platform for education and learning. Many educational institutions, teachers, and students use the platform to share resources, discuss topics, and collaborate on projects. This has opened up new opportunities for learning and knowledge sharing.

5. Entertainment

Malaysians love their entertainment, and Facebook has become a popular platform for content creators, influencers, and celebrities to share their work. From comedy skits to cooking tutorials, Facebook offers a wide range of entertainment options for users to enjoy.
